在患有1型糖尿病的儿童中,与高血糖相关的炎症特征
Nicole Glaser1, Zachary Chaffin2, Daniel Tancredi1
1Section of Endocrinology, Department of Pediatrics, University of California Davis School of Medicine, Sacramento, CA, USA.
患有1型糖尿病 (T1D) 的儿童的高血糖 (高血糖) 与广泛的炎症标志物有关. 这些变化可能会在严重的T1D并发症发生之前发生.

背景情况:
- 1型糖尿病 (T1D) 的并发症与高血糖有关.
- 炎症在T1D并发症中起作用,但其与各种介导体的高血糖症的关联尚未完全理解.
- 在儿科T1D中,与高血糖相关的炎症概况的描述至关重要.
研究的目的:
- 综合描述与T1D儿童高血糖相关的炎症概况.
- 研究血糖控制 (HbA1c) 与广泛的炎症媒介之间的关系.
- 为了确定T1D并发症的潜在早期生物标志物.
主要方法:
- 多重免疫测试用于评估T1D的117名儿童的血液炎症媒介 (细胞因子,化学因子,生长因子,MMP)
- 多个线性回归分析评估了炎症媒介和HbA1c之间的关系,并根据相关的共变量进行调整.
- 计算了炎症综合得分,以表示整体炎症状况.
主要成果:
- 许多炎症调解剂,包括各种细胞因子,化学因子,生长因子和MMP,与HbA1c水平显著相关 (p < 0.05,FDR q < 0.10).
- 具体的例子包括IL-1β,IL-6,TNF-α,CCL2,CXCL8,VEGF-A和MMP-1等.
- 1%的HbA1c增加与0.16的炎症综合评分增加有关.
结论:
- 广泛的炎症调解剂与T1D儿童的HbA1c相关.
- 这些炎症变化可能会先于T1D并发症的临床表现.
- 需要进一步研究这些炎症变化的病理生理学作用.
